Christmas with Elizabeth is one of those Kachyňa-Procházka films that center around a vulnerable young person. Pavla Kárníková is, same as Robert Lischke in Shadows of a Hot Summer, an example of an actor delivering an impressive debut performance and then disappearing from the film industry. Here she is cast next to the already experienced Vlado Müller, who would go on to act for another quarter of a century. Together they portrayed an unlikely pair of souls searching for a connection with each other and themselves. The groundedness and emotional intimity of the story is emphasized by reserved acting performances, unembellished spaces and limited time frame in which the meeting of Elizabeth and Hubert takes place.
